Green Mountain expands capacity at Norwegian data centre

Green Mountain adds 4,5 MW of capacity to its existing data center facility at Rjukan in Norway. The expansion is a build-to-suit project for a new world-known international client. The construction is estimated to be completed in September 2022 and strengthens the site as a High Performance Computing cluster.
